Overview of Red Bottlebrush: The Red Bottlebrush, scientifically known as Calistemon viminalis, is a native Australian tree that has found its place in the hearts of Florida gardeners. With its striking flowers and graceful appearance, this tree has become a popular choice for adding a touch of brilliance to landscapes throughout the state.

Features and Appearance: Red Bottlebrush trees typically reach heights of 15 to 25 feet (4.5 to 7.5 meters), making them perfectly suited for both small and large gardens in Florida. Their pendulous branches create a weeping form, adding an elegant focal point to your outdoor spaces. The foliage consists of narrow, glossy green leaves that maintain their beauty year-round.

Captivating Blooms: One of the standout features of the Red Bottlebrush is its vibrant red flowers. During the spring and summer months, these blossoms burst forth in profusion, adorning the tree with their distinctive bottlebrush-shaped clusters. The bright red blooms are not only visually captivating but also attract hummingbirds, bees, and butterflies, bringing your Florida garden to life with the delightful buzz of pollinators. The vivid contrast between the red flowers and the green foliage adds a burst of color to your landscape.

Low Maintenance and Drought Tolerance: The Red Bottlebrush is renowned for its resilience and adaptability, making it an excellent choice for Florida gardeners seeking low-maintenance plants. Once established, this tree exhibits exceptional drought tolerance. It can also withstand a variety of soil conditions, including the sandy soils commonly found in the state. While regular watering during the establishment phase is recommended, the Red Bottlebrush can flourish with minimal supplemental irrigation once it is well-established.

Versatile Landscaping Applications: Whether you are designing a formal garden, creating a naturalistic landscape, or seeking a standout specimen tree for your Florida backyard, the Red Bottlebrush offers versatility in its application. Its graceful form and vibrant flowers make it an excellent choice as a standalone feature tree, providing a stunning focal point. You can also use it in group plantings or as an attractive privacy screen to enhance your outdoor spaces.

Pruning and Maintenance: To maintain the Red Bottlebrush’s elegant form and promote healthy growth, occasional pruning is recommended. After the flowering period, remove spent blooms and shape the tree as desired. Pruning should focus on removing dead or damaged branches and thinning out excessive growth.
